Why Chapter 13 Bankruptcy May Be the Smart Choice

Unlike Chapter 7, which can require liquidation of assets, Chapter 13 is a repayment plan designed to help homeowners keep what they’ve worked for. For Santa Rosa Valley residents with equity in their property or steady income, it can be the most practical approach.

Key benefits include:

  • Stops foreclosure immediately: Filing triggers an automatic stay halting lender action.
  • Repay missed payments: Catch up on mortgage arrears over 3–5 years.
  • Consolidate debts: Simplify repayment of credit cards, medical bills, and personal loans into one monthly payment.
  • Protect valuable property: California exemptions allow you to keep your home, vehicles, and essential assets.

Chapter 13 is about buying time—and creating a plan you can actually afford.

The Chapter 13 Process in Practice

Filing for Chapter 13 isn’t simple, but it’s manageable with the right help. Here’s what you can expect:

  1. Financial Assessment: A complete review of your income, debts, assets, and expenses.
  2. Plan Development: Crafting a realistic payment schedule the court will approve.
  3. Filing the Petition: Activates the automatic stay to stop foreclosure and creditor calls.
  4. 341 Meeting: You’ll answer trustee questions about your plan.
  5. Execution: Make consistent payments over 3–5 years, keeping your property while catching up on arrears.

Protecting Your Property and Livelihood

California’s exemption laws are especially helpful in protecting:

  • Substantial home equity within homestead limits
  • Vehicles needed for commuting, business, or family needs
  • Farm equipment, tools, and supplies required for work
  • Essential household furniture, appliances, and clothing
  • Retirement savings and pensions
